Bassist Steve Messick and his hard bop jazz quintet, the Endemic Ensemble, make their first appearance at Egan's Ballard Jam House, in a continued celebration of their 2016 release of "Tangled," which is the band's second full-length album of original jazz.

Founded in early 2010, the Endemic Ensemble is a modern, collaborative jazz quintet based in Seattle. The music, composed by Messick, Franklin, and Limtiaco, is influenced by '60s hard bop, big band, and 19th and 20th century classical music, and is described as having "swinging rhythm, great tunes and purposeful playing - always in the service of the song, and usually anchored in the blues" (Lucid Culture).
